Photography, Reconstruction and the Cultural History of the Postwar European City
Language: en
Pages: 272
Authors: Tom Allbeson
Categories: Photography
Type: BOOK - Published: 2020-11-17 - Publisher: Routledge

Examining imagery of urban space in Britain, France and West Germany up to the early 1960s, this book reveals how photography shaped individual architectural projects and national rebuilding efforts alike. Art and Masculinity in Post-War Britain
Language: en
Pages: 224
Authors: Gregory Salter
Categories: Social Science
Type: BOOK - Published: 2020-05-18 - Publisher: Routledge

In this book, Gregory Salter traces how artists represented home and masculinities in the period of social and personal reconstruction after the Second World War in Britain.
